Abstract

The utility model discloses a switch bracket with electric operation, which comprises a bracket main body, wherein clamping rings are arranged at the top ends of the bracket main body, adjusting structures are arranged on one sides of the clamping rings, mounting structures are arranged on one sides of the inside of the bracket main body, electric push rods are arranged at the bottom ends of guide rings, and guide frames are arranged at the bottom ends of the electric push rods. According to the utility model, the electric mechanism is arranged at the bottom end of the bracket main body, and the electric push rod in the electric mechanism is started to push the bracket main body to move back and forth in the using process of the switch bracket, so that the switch assembly in the bracket main body can be moved back and forth, the switch assembly can be conveniently stored in the corresponding mounting groove to avoid the external false touch and the corresponding dust-proof protection, and meanwhile, the switch assembly is more convenient to pop up and store and use due to the adoption of electric power, and the use effect is better.

Description

Switch bracket with electric operation
Technical Field
The utility model relates to the technical field of switches, in particular to a switch bracket with power operation.
Background
The switch support is a support for supporting the switch assembly, the switch assembly is installed in the switch support during use, the switch assembly is installed in the corresponding installation groove through the switch support and then used, the switch assembly is normally in an exposed state when being installed and used, the phenomenon of false touch is easy to occur, dust can fall on the surface to cause damage, and certain protection is absent, so that the switch support with electric operation is provided at present, the switch assembly can be driven to stretch out and be hidden through the electric operation, the operation is simple and convenient, the switch assembly can be hidden, dust prevention and false touch prevention can be realized, and the use effect is better.
Disclosure of Invention
The utility model aims to provide a switch bracket with power operation, so as to solve the problems of lack of protection and inconvenient use in the prior art.
In order to achieve the above purpose, the present utility model provides the following technical solutions: take electrically operated's switch support, including the support main part, the snap ring is all installed on the top of support main part, one side of snap ring all is provided with adjusting structure, one side of support main part inside all is provided with mounting structure, the bottom of support main part all is provided with electric mechanism, electric mechanism includes the guide ring, electric putter is all installed to the bottom of guide ring, electric putter's bottom all is provided with the leading truck.
Preferably, the cross section of the guide ring is larger than that of the bracket main body, and a sliding structure is formed between the guide ring and the bracket main body.
Preferably, the mounting structure comprises a spring, the spring is mounted on one side of the support body, the mounting blocks are mounted on one sides of the spring, and the rubber blocks are mounted on one sides of the mounting blocks.
Preferably, the springs are arranged in a plurality, and the springs are distributed at equal intervals on one side of the mounting block.
Preferably, the adjusting structure comprises an adjusting groove, the adjusting groove is arranged on one side of the inside of the clamping ring, an adjusting rod is movably arranged in the adjusting groove, a fixing bolt is arranged on one side of the inside of the adjusting rod, and a hole body is arranged in the adjusting groove.
Preferably, the hole body is provided with a plurality of hole bodies, and the hole bodies are distributed at equal intervals in the adjusting groove.
Preferably, the cross section of the adjusting rod is smaller than that of the adjusting groove, and a clamping structure is formed between the adjusting rod and the adjusting groove.
Compared with the prior art, the utility model has the beneficial effects that: the switch bracket with power operation is reasonable in structure and has the following advantages:
(1) Through being provided with electric mechanism, electric motor constructs the bottom that sets up in the support main part, and the in-process that this switch support used is through being provided with electric mechanism, and electric putter in the electric mechanism starts and can promote the support main part and reciprocate to carry out a back-and-forth movement to the inside switch module of support main part, thereby be convenient for accomodate the switch module in the inside mistake of avoiding outside of corresponding mounting groove and bump and carry out corresponding dustproof protection, adopt the electric messenger simultaneously this switch module pop out with accomodate the use more convenient, excellent in use effect;
(2) Through being provided with the regulation structure, the switch support of different widths can be encountered in the process of installing the switch assembly by the switch support, one regulation can be carried out between the switches through being provided with the regulation structure, and the switch support is regulated to be applicable to the installation of the switch assembly with different widths, so that the switch support has adjustability, and the applicability of the use of the switch support is greatly increased;
(3) Through being provided with mounting structure, mounting structure sets up in one side of support main part, and switch module installs in the inside back of this switch support, can promote the installation piece through the spring in the mounting structure of setting and carry out spacingly to switch module for switch module firm installation is in the inside of switch support, has realized that this switch support is convenient for install switch module, thereby makes the convenience greatly increased of this switch module installation.

Detailed Description
The following description of the embodiments of the present utility model will be made clearly and completely with reference to the accompanying drawings, in which it is apparent that the embodiments described are only some embodiments of the present utility model, but not all embodiments. All other embodiments, which can be made by those skilled in the art based on the embodiments of the utility model without making any inventive effort, are intended to be within the scope of the utility model.
Referring to fig. 1-4, an embodiment of the present utility model is provided: the switch support with the electric operation comprises a support body 1, wherein a clamping ring 4 is arranged at the top end of the support body 1, an adjusting structure 3 is arranged on one side of the clamping ring 4, an installing structure 2 is arranged on one side of the inside of the support body 1, an electric mechanism 5 is arranged at the bottom end of the support body 1, the electric mechanism 5 comprises a guide ring 503, an electric push rod 501 is arranged at the bottom end of the guide ring 503, and a guide frame 502 is arranged at the bottom end of the electric push rod 501;
the cross section of the guide ring 503 is larger than that of the bracket main body 1, a sliding structure is formed between the guide ring 503 and the bracket main body 1, and the sliding structure is designed to guide the front and back movement of the bracket main body 1, so that the front and back movement of the bracket main body 1 is more stable, and the switch assembly is driven to move stably;
specifically, as shown in fig. 1 and fig. 4, when in use, the switch assembly is installed in the corresponding installation groove by the bracket main body 1, and when in use, the switch bracket is pushed to move back and forth to move out of the installation groove to operate by starting the electric push rod 501 through the guide of the guide ring 503 on the outer side wall of the guide frame 502, and after the operation is completed, the switch assembly which is installed in the bracket main body 1 can be driven to be stored in the original place by starting the electric push rod 501 again, so that the use effect is better.
The mounting structure 2 comprises a spring 201, wherein the spring 201 is mounted on one side of the bracket main body 1, mounting blocks 203 are mounted on one side of the spring 201, and rubber blocks 202 are mounted on one side of the mounting blocks 203;
the springs 201 are arranged in a plurality, the springs 201 are distributed at equal intervals on one side of the mounting block 203, the elastic expansion force of the mounting block 203 is better due to the equidistant distributed springs 201, the clamping and mounting effects on the switch assembly are better, and meanwhile, the rubber block 202 used on one side of the mounting block 203 can avoid abrasion on the surface of the switch assembly when the switch assembly is clamped and mounted;
specifically, as shown in fig. 1 and 4, during use, the switch assembly is mounted and clamped into the bracket main body 1, and the mounting blocks 203 on two sides of the bracket main body 1 are attached to two sides of the switch assembly to limit the switch assembly under the elastic pushing of the spring 201, so that the switch assembly is mounted in the bracket main body 1 in a clamping manner, and the mounting mode is simple and convenient.
The adjusting structure 3 comprises an adjusting groove 301, wherein the adjusting groove 301 is arranged on one side of the inside of the clamping ring 4, an adjusting rod 304 is movably arranged in the adjusting groove 301, a fixing bolt 303 is arranged on one side of the inside of the adjusting rod 304, and a hole body 302 is arranged in the adjusting groove 301;
the hole bodies 302 are arranged in a plurality, the hole bodies 302 are distributed at equal intervals in the adjusting groove 301, the hole bodies 302 distributed at equal intervals are convenient for adjusting the clamping ring 4 to different intervals, and the applicability is greatly improved;
the cross section of the adjusting rod 304 is smaller than that of the adjusting groove 301, a clamping structure is formed between the adjusting rod 304 and the adjusting groove 301, and the clamping structure is designed to enable the adjusted clamping ring 4 to be more firmly installed;
specifically, as shown in fig. 1 and 3, when the clamp rings 4 are used, if the width between the clamp rings 4 is to be adjusted, the distance between the two groups of clamp rings 4 is adjusted to a proper size by unscrewing the fixing bolt 303 through the movement of the adjusting rod 304 in the adjusting groove 301, and then the distance between the two groups of clamp rings 4 is adjusted by screwing the fixing bolt 303 into the corresponding hole 302.
Working principle: when the live-line operation support is used, the switch support and the switch assembly are taken out, the width of the switch support is adjusted according to the actual width of the switch assembly, the fixing bolt 303 is unscrewed to pull the snap rings 4 to two sides during adjustment, the distance between the two groups of snap rings 4 is adjusted to a proper size, then the fixing bolt 303 is screwed into the corresponding hole body 302 to fix the two groups of adjusted snap rings 4, then the switch assembly is taken out to be placed in the support body 1, the rubber blocks 202 on one side of the installation block 203 are pushed by the springs 201 on two sides of the interior of the support body 1 to be attached to two sides of the switch assembly for clamping, the switch assembly is installed in the interior of the support body 1, after the switch assembly is installed, the switch assembly is installed at the corresponding installation position through the fixing piece at the bottom end of the guide frame 502, then in the use process of the switch assembly, the electric push rod 501 is started to push the guide ring 503 to move up and down so as to push the support body 1, the switch assembly in the support body 1 is pushed out for operation, the electric push rod 501 is started again to be retracted into the installation groove to be placed in the installation groove for storage of the switch assembly, and finally the live-line operation support can be completed.
